HB 1596 Virginia House of Delegates · 2025 Regular Session

Department of Medical Assistance Services; state plan for medical assistance services; telemedicine services.

Summary
Department of Medical Assistance Services; state plan for medical assistance services; telemedicine services. Changes the definition of "telemedicine services" as it is used in the state plan for medical assistance services to include two-way, real-time, audio-only communication technology for any telehealth service furnished to a patient in his home.
